## 3.1.0 — Key rotation

Rotated signing key used by Pinwright to verify pinned dependency manifests. Old key revoked effective immediately. Builds referencing manifests signed pre-rotation will fail verification; re-run the pin job to re-sign. Policy docs updated. On-call: no paging expected, but watch the verify queue overnight. New key follows.

deploy key for kajof-fajop: bky6_gDHw9Q

### Changed defaults: canary gating

Heads up if you're new to the Copperline deploy pipeline — we tightened the canary gating rules this week. Canaries now need 30 minutes of clean error-rate and latency metrics before auto-promotion, up from 10, and any single 5xx spike above baseline pauses the rollout instead of just logging a warning. Manual overrides still work, but they now require a stated reason. The gating service ships with these default configuration values.

service settings:
novath:
  pin: 1396
  tenant: pelys
  seal: seal_ccc035e1
  metrics_host: metrics.novath.qorvelworks.test
  standby_team: fraeth
  escalation: drueth-zorok
  nonce: 61d508

Finance Review Summary — Board Distribution

The six-store pilot with Marloway Retail Group concluded on schedule. Revenue tracked 8% above forecast; fulfillment costs ran slightly over plan due to courier rates in the Ostermead region. Margins remain acceptable. Marloway has signaled interest in a wider rollout next quarter. Strategic context for that discussion appears in the confidential note below.

management briefing: Ralokix Partners plans to lower the Istath list price by 38 percent in October.

**Mgmt Meeting Minutes — Retiring the Brightline Range**

Quick recap for sales leads at Fenholt Supplies: we agreed to retire the Brightline fixture range by year-end. Remaining stock moves to clearance pricing next month, and accounts on standing orders get migrated to the Lumetta range. Trade-in incentives were approved in principle. The confidential note on next steps sits just below.

board note of bajof-bajeg: The pricing group signed off on a budget of $13.4 million for Project Sildor. The renewal with Lamixek Holdings closes at $48.9 million a year, 49 percent above the last contract.